gopls (Go Language Server)
Rank #7657pulsemcp/yantrio-gopls
Wraps gopls (Go language server) to provide Go development tools including go-to-definition, find references, hover information, diagnostics, and workspace symbol search for code navigation and analysis.
gopls (Go Language Server) is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server published by yantrio.
